A permit is generally required to remove native vegetation in the Macedon Ranges.
Revegetation is best carried out using local indigenous plants.The Macedon Ranges Shire contains many different ecosystems that are characterised by different types of plants. These ecosystems are known as ecological vegetation classes (EVCs).
